Commissioners remove proposed executive-session items citing attorney-client confidentiality statute

Board of Cleveland County Commissioners · September 15, 2025

Summary

The board voted to strike two proposed executive-session items (K and L) referencing confidential communications with counsel under 25 O.S. §307(B)(4).

Chairman Jacob McHughes moved, seconded by Commissioner Rod Cleveland, to strike Items K and L from the agenda. Both items referenced confidential communications with the board’s attorney pursuant to 25 O.S. §307(B)(4) concerning pending investigations or litigation. Commissioners voted unanimously to remove the items; no executive session was held and no action was recorded beyond striking the items from the agenda.

The minutes record the statutory basis cited in the agenda language but do not include any discussion of the underlying subject matter that prompted the proposed executive-session items.
